Negro League player stats include league games, interleague games (against major Negro League competition), and games against select top-level independent Black Baseball teams. Player stats do not include the extensive amount of exhibitions and barnstorming games Negro League teams often played. Negro League data is not complete. Research is still ongoing and we’ll continue to publish updates as more information becomes available. More about data coverage

Frequently Asked Questions

When was Nip Winters born?

Nip Winters was born on April 29, 1899.

Where was Nip Winters born?

Nip Winters was born in Washington, DC.

How tall was Nip Winters?

Nip Winters was 6-2 (188 cm) tall.

How much did Nip Winters weigh when playing?

Nip Winters weighed 180 lbs (81 kg) when playing.

How many seasons did Nip Winters play?

Nip Winters played 8 seasons.

Is Nip Winters in the Hall of Fame?

Nip Winters has not been elected into the Hall of Fame.

What position did Nip Winters play?

Nip Winters was a Pitcher and First Baseman.

How many strikeouts did Nip Winters have?

Nip Winters had 546 strikeouts over his career.

How many teams has Nip Winters played for?

Nip Winters played for 5 teams; the Hilldale Club, New York Lincoln Giants, Baltimore Black Sox, New York Lincoln Giants and Washington Pilots.

How many World Series has Nip Winters won?

Nip Winters won 1 World Series.

When did Nip Winters retire?

Nip Winters last played in 1932.
